Choosing the right septic system is essential for sustaining an environment friendly, environmentally friendly, and cost-effective waste administration solution. Septic systems are designed to treat wastewater from homes that are not related to a centralized sewer system. The right choice is dependent upon numerous elements, together with soil conditions, local regulations, water utilization, and finances constraints.
The primary function of a septic system is to handle the waste generated by a household. It sometimes consists of a septic tank, a distribution field, and a drain area. In a septic tank, solids settle at the backside, while liquid effluent flows into the drain field for further treatment via soil filtration. Understanding how every part works is crucial for choosing the proper system.
One of the primary considerations in deciding on a septic system is the soil type and its ability to empty. A percolation test, or "perc test," assesses how nicely soil can take up and filter wastewater. Well-drained soil is critical for a conventional septic system, whereas heavy clay or rocky soil could require another solution, corresponding to a mound system or a sand filter.
Native regulations and zoning legal guidelines also play a big role in determining the type of septic system that may be installed. Many areas have strict pointers concerning web site evaluations, septic system design, and installation procedures. Householders should seek the advice of with local health departments and acquainted specialists to make sure compliance and keep away from potential fines or pricey reinstallation.

The measurement of the septic system should be appropriate for the household’s water usage. Components such as the number of occupants, life-style habits, and water fixtures directly influence the quantity of wastewater generated. An undersized system can result in frequent backups and costly repairs, while an oversized system may be an unnecessary expense.
Residential septic systems are obtainable in various varieties, together with standard systems, aerobic treatment models, drip irrigation methods, and extra. Every option has unique features and benefits. Conventional systems are traditional and commonly used. Cardio treatment techniques use oxygen to boost the breakdown of waste, making them effective for smaller tons or difficult soil varieties.
Mound techniques can be a suitable alternative for homes built on soil that doesn’t drain well. They work by elevating the drain field above the natural soil degree, making certain enough drainage. This kind calls for thorough planning and better building prices, however it can be the perfect solution in challenging environments.
Another key factor is maintenance. Regular inspection and pumping of the septic tank are essential to prolonging its life. Householders ought to concentrate on the signs of a failing system, such as sluggish drains, foul odors, or standing water close to the drain subject. These signs usually point out a necessity for quick attention.

Deciding On the best septic system also includes contemplating environmental impacts. Some householders may opt for techniques that embrace advanced treatment methods to scale back nutrient runoff, which may hurt local water our bodies. Eco-friendly options can increase soil absorption and support sustainable practices.
Financial considerations are of utmost importance when choosing the proper septic system.
